Friday Frocks: Skin in the Game

By |August 31st, 2012|Friday Frocks, Why Did You Wear That?|

leather dressIn case you didn’t get the memo last fall, you’re going to need a leather dress come this autumn.  The ultimate update to your standard LBD, leather will not only keep you warm thermostatically speaking, but will also have you looking hot literally speaking.  Should you opt to go all in, a leather shift is a fantastic transitional piece that can eventually be layered over a turtleneck and tights.  Feeling more modest?  Opt for a frock with leather details or panels to achieve the same leather look.

Friday Frocks: Thankful for Sweater Dresses

By |November 18th, 2011|Friday Frocks, Why Did You Wear That?|

Alright, so we are gearing up for a big week next week.  Big in terms of family, cooking, and our stomachs.  That’s right, Thanksgiving is right around the corner (ahem- next Thursday).  This holiday means many things- one of which is failing miserably at portion control.  Aunt Mimi’s pie is just too good.  While I’d rather just wear something from tent and awning, it is possible that you’ll be spending this special day with a special someone’s family… So, you’ll have to look (somewhat) presentable.  Next best thing to wrapping yourself in a duvet?  The oh so effortless sweater dress.  It’s cozy, it’s cute, and it allows for an extra piece of pie.  Wear yours with textured tights (or sweater leggings) and flat boots for a pulled together, yet totally relaxed look.
